[Comparative study of 201Tl and 99mTc-MIBI in breast tumor]. 1996

N Fukumitsu, and M Tozaki, and M Uchiyama, and Y Mori, and K Kawakami, and K Uchida
Department of Radiology, Jikei University school of Medicine.

A comparative study of 201Tl and 99mTc-MIBI was performed in 39 breast tumors. 201Tl scintigraphy was carried out in 24 breast tumors and 99mTc-MIBI scintigraphy in 15. The sensitivity of 201Tl for malignant tumors was 100% (22/22), but specificity was 0% (0/2). On 99mTc-MIBI scintigraphy, the sensitivity for the malignant tumors was 83.3% (10/12) and specificity was 100% (3/3). 99Tc-MIBI might be more useful for the diagnosis of breast tumors, because the tumor/background ratio of 99mTc-MIBI was significantly higher than that of 201Tl. In addition, 201Tl scintigraphy and 99mTc-MIBI scintigraphy showed the same degree of accuracy (93.3%) in diagnosis of lymph node reached. Moreover, when either US and 201Tl or 99mTc-MIBI scintigraphy was positive for lymph node metastasis, accuracy of detection of lymph node metastasis became 94.4%. A combined study of US and scintigraphy might improve the accuracy for diagnosis of lymph node metastasis.

D015899 Tomography, Emission-Computed, Single-Photon A method of computed tomography that uses radionuclides which emit a single photon of a given energy. The camera is rotated 180 or 360 degrees around the patient to capture images at multiple positions along the arc. The computer is then used to reconstruct the transaxial, sagittal, and coronal images from the 3-dimensional distribution of radionuclides in the organ. The advantages of SPECT are that it can be used to observe biochemical and physiological processes as well as size and volume of the organ. The disadvantage is that, unlike positron-emission tomography where the positron-electron annihilation results in the emission of 2 photons at 180 degrees from each other, SPECT requires physical collimation to line up the photons, which results in the loss of many available photons and hence degrades the image.
